#1fd408 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1fd408 is composed of 12.2% red, 83.1%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.2%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 113.2 degrees, a saturation of 92.7% and a lightness of 43.1%. #1fd408 color hex could be obtained by blending #3eff10 with #00a900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

Shades and Tints of #1fd408
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010400 is the darkest color, while #f2fef0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1fd408
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e6e6e is the less saturated color, while #1fd408 is the most saturated one.
